The joys of single speed nicely executed

I've never been into sportier bikes or riding fast, but this is a different approach to that style of riding, the need to read the road ahead and when needed give it all you've got for a short while to get over the incline then it's back to my more normal pace and very surprised just how much hill climbing can be done, we have some big hilly area's here so I keep away from there but lots of more undulating countryside too and that's my S/S playground, becoming a big fan of my Spa Mono.
